United Group, the leading telecoms and media operator in Southeast Europe majority owned by BC Partners, announces that its Greek subsidiary Nova has signed an agreement to sell its 50% shareholding in Nova ICT to IREON Technologies, a member of the Motor Oil Group.
The transaction continues United Group’s programme of concentrating capital and management attention on its core telecoms and media businesses. Nova ICT, a systems integration and digital solutions business, was established in 2023 with initial share capital of €1 million. As part of the transaction, its net equity value was assessed at €121 million, reflecting the growth the business has achieved in three years under the leadership of CEO Alexandros Bregiannis, including complex projects in healthcare, civil protection, defence, infrastructure and utilities, and a growing portfolio of EU-funded work.
The transaction has no impact on the group’s leverage metrics, and the consideration received represents incremental cash proceeds to the group.
For Nova, the sale allows full focus on its strategy of providing affordable, high-quality connectivity and content to Greek households and businesses, on building stable, recurring revenue streams, and on continued investment in next-generation networks including 5G.
Nova and Nova ICT will maintain their commercial partnership after completion and will continue to work together on large-scale digital transformation projects.
Stan Miller, CEO of United Group, said: “We allocate capital with discipline, and that means knowing when to invest and when to realise value. Nova ICT was built into one of the leading digital solutions businesses in Greece, and this transaction crystallises that value at the right moment for both companies. Alexandros and his team have done an outstanding job, and the commercial partnership between Nova and Nova ICT will continue.”
Nikos Stathopoulos, Chairman, Europe, BC Partners, said: “In three years Nova ICT has grown from an initial share capital of €1 million to an equity value of €121 million, and the group is realising that value while keeping its focus on market-leading telecoms and media businesses in its core European markets. It shows the strength of the model: strong local management teams building businesses of real value, and a group that knows how to back them and when to monetise them.”
